when untaring a large file 3.5gig with 500.000 files I got an out of memory error box half way on untaring the file. This happens on 7.02a
This file was made with an older version of totalcommander

Try unpacking the file with Alt+F9 (unpack specific files) while the TAR file is closed instead of opening the file with Enter, this takes much less memory and should also be faster.
